From e15a656479711bcb6587e24bbc44c97897f2a27f Mon Sep 17 00:00:00 2001 From: Lachlan Kermode Date: Mon, 10 Dec 2018 16:44:27 +0000 Subject: [PATCH] pass loading to CardSource --- src/components/Card.jsx | 1 + src/components/presentational/CardSource.js | 19 ++++++++++--------- 2 files changed, 11 insertions(+), 9 deletions(-) diff --git a/src/components/Card.jsx b/src/components/Card.jsx index 7d77a03..9c65c2a 100644 --- a/src/components/Card.jsx +++ b/src/components/Card.jsx @@ -89,6 +89,7 @@ class Card extends React.Component { renderSource() { return ( diff --git a/src/components/presentational/CardSource.js b/src/components/presentational/CardSource.js index b234143..d82085d 100644 --- a/src/components/presentational/CardSource.js +++ b/src/components/presentational/CardSource.js @@ -2,16 +2,17 @@ import React from 'react'; import copy from '../../js/data/copy.json'; -const CardSource = ({ source, language }) => { - const source_lang = copy[language].cardstack.source; - if (!source) source = copy[language].cardstack.unknown_source; +const CardSource = ({ source, language, isLoading }) => { + const source_lang = copy[language].cardstack.source; + if (!source) source = copy[language].cardstack.unknown_source; + console.log(isLoading) - return ( -
-

{source_lang}:

-

{source}

-
- ); + return ( +
+

{source_lang}:

+

{source}

+
+ ); } export default CardSource;